The residuals on the M5 have remained stable since January 2019. My guess is that the earliest the 2019 programs will improve is when the initial lease programs come out for the 2020 M5 in July 2019. Those 2020 cars won't actually be on the ground in USA until August 2019 at the earliest.
So those hoping to get an increase on their 2019 M5 residuals will have to wait another 30 or so days to take delivery.

This is for a MY 2020 M5 Comp special order
MSRP $148,745 selling price 133541 (10% off MSRP) Assuming current lease rates for the 2020 10k/36 55% residual MF 0.00165 $1990 Monthly including NYC taxes With Max MSDs total comes out to $1898. drive off is first months payment, Acquisition and DMV. would like to know your opinions. I agree 10% off seems really good. I am trying to pick up a 2019 that's on the lot and the most I am seeing with a discount to purchase is about 4% off msrp that coupled with no current finance incentives does not make for an attractive offer. Of course if I lease theres the $5K lease credit which gets close to 10% but I usually pay invoice minus any available incentives when I buy M's. Not to mention there is a ton of inventory on the West coast.
Strange that dealers are portraying that the M5 still remains some hot commodity. |
